Definition of Animalize

1. Verb. Represent in the form of an animal.

Exact synonyms: Animalise
Generic synonyms: Interpret, Represent
Derivative terms: Animal, Animal

2. Verb. Make brutal, unfeeling, or inhuman. "Life in the camps had brutalized him"
Exact synonyms: Animalise, Brutalise, Brutalize
Generic synonyms: Alter, Change, Modify
Derivative terms: Brutalisation, Brutal, Brutalization

3. Verb. Become brutal or insensitive and unfeeling.
Exact synonyms: Animalise, Brutalise, Brutalize
Generic synonyms: Change
Derivative terms: Brutalisation, Brutal, Brutalization

Definition of Animalize

1. v. t. To endow with the properties of an animal; to represent in animal form.
